Thyne Again Returns To Winning Ways At Naas

Thyne Again jumped his way back into the Arkle picture with an extremely comfortable 21-length success in the Grade Woodlands Park 100 Nas Na Riogh Novice Chase.

The Liam Burke trained seven-year-old was a disappointing fourth behind J?y Vole at Fairyhouse last time out but well and truly reversed that form on this occasion with 8/13 shot J?y Vole only managing to trail in third having never really travelled with her normal zest.

Thyne Again took it up after the second last and soon asserted to land the spoils with Davy Russell doing the steering.

Russell remarked, ?He done it well and he settled and jumped great and he is getting better with every run.?

While the winning trainer was looking forward to a possible assault on the Arkle, ?He did that nicely and if the ground at Cheltenham was safe we will have to go to the Arkle but there will have to be a good cut in the ground. I won?t risk him as he will be a lovely horse for next year.?

When asked about the manner of Thyne Again?s victory, Burke responded, ?I was very disappointed with him the last day and I certainly didn?t think the weight beat him. He didn?t jump good enough that day to be going for a race like an Arkle but he had a good experience today.?

Burke concluded, ?It was rotten ground today but he jumped well today and was always safe, he wants plenty of light at his fences and when he got that he was very good. He always promised to be a nice horse and I wouldn?t mind having a few more like him.?
